" Oh, Beautiful Virgin Islands " is the territorial song of the British Virgin Islands. It was adopted as the territorial song by resolution of the House of Assembly of the Virgin Islands on 24 July 2012. Since the Virgin Islands is a British Overseas Territory, the official national anthem is "God Save the King".
